Congrats on the new Salsa!

Heres my xB comp install:
https://www.scionlife.com/forums/vie...789&highlight=

You can see some of whats behind the panels. You may/may not need 2 layers of 3/4" MDF. Depends on your speaker depth. Mine are 2.8", needed 2 layers for 1/4"~3/8" clearance to glass.

^^ NO! NO hacky the door panel! Arrghh!

Completely stock look. The ring removed is inside the door panel. And thats with the 2x 3/4" MDF spacers.

Also, its a non destructive install. If, for some reason (selling?) you wanted to replace the stock stuff, its a no brainer. No cut harnesses, no jacked panels,

PM your email addy for spacer templates. Know that these will work with eDi 6000s/6500s @ 6-1/2" nominal x 2.8" deep. Make adjustments to depth and diameter based on your final speaker choice.
